Conservatories
Conservatories are popular with homeowners who want a room that blends with their gardens and homes they provide areas for dining or relaxation and lots of sunlight. The styles include bay-end, rectangular, lean-to, and orangery. The design should compliment and enhance the current property, and not make an appearance as an addition. The style should also be in harmony with the surrounding landscape and provide an unobstructed view of your garden. Good designs for conservatories take into consideration the height of the surrounding structure and the grounds, the correct alignment of door and
window cleaning service rails and stiles windows patterns roof pitch, and the correct proportions of the elements of the design.
A conservatory is a kind of glass extension to your home, typically with a glass or polycarbonate roof and walls. The first time they were used, they were to preserve citrus and other delicate plants brought to England from warmer climates, they soon became a popular spot to enjoy warm weather outside without being exposed to the elements of wind and rain. Conservatories can be free-standing garden building or it can be constructed on the foundation of an existing home.
Water leaks are usually the first indication of a conservatory that needs to be repaired. They can cause damage to flooring and walls, and even mildew. However, a skilled joiner can often repair the problem with splicing in new sections of timber, or by repairing rotten areas. Utilizing the correct seals and fixing the conservatory properly will help prevent future problems.
Water Damage
If your window or door has been damaged by water, it's essential to call an expert before the damage gets too severe. If the issue is not addressed the damage can spread and a whole host of problems can develop, including mildew, mold, wood rot, structural damage and biohazard contaminants. These contaminants can be harmful to your family members and your property.
It is sometimes difficult to spot subtle leaks and damage. Be aware of signs of damage such as the feeling of mushy or soft on the ceilings, walls and flooring. Be alert for signs of swollen windows and doors, as well as musty smells.
Water damage can cause the growth and contamination of surfaces in your house like tiles, carpeting, and drywall. If not treated, the surfaces could become a breeding place for chemicals, fungi, and viruses that can trigger respiratory issues skin irritations, respiratory problems, and severe illnesses.
